i'm looking at an XT M8000 drivetrain bundle. if i buy the 2x setup with 2x rings and shifters and mechs, could i also buy a 30t 1x ring and swap it for the 2x rings? and remove the front shifter and front mech?

I've recently looked into changing my 2x m8000 chainset into a 1x. As best as I can tell its the same crank for both.

This makes me think that the chainline might be sub-optimal unless the single ring has spacers to bring it inboard a little.

It's the same crank for 2x and 1x. If you're fitting a single ring then get some spacers and longer bolts.

Ive recently converted my M8000 1x11 cranks to 2x11, the chainring spacing seemed exactly the same as a purchased 2x11. I actually used the m7000 slx rings on it, as these are steel and plastic, rather than the XT's alloy rings, so hopefully will last a bit longer.
one thing i did notice when setting up the derailleurs was that the chain kicked inwards at a certain point of the crank turn as it went around the large chainring - I eventually found the reason to be the small chainring spacer that sits behind the crankarm, to stop the chain dropping behind it, was actually a few mm longer than the gap, and was actually pushing against the chainring, causing it to deflect - a few minutes with the dremel soon sorted it. - Something to be aware of though, might be because the rings were from a non boost slx crank, and the XT was boost?
